PLAY FIGHTING BEAR CUB TRIPLETS

Trading blows and brawling in the grass, two Kamchatka brown bear cubs go paw-to-paw while their sibling referees their playfight. With the adorable cubs distracted, the mother bear has time to fish for dinner as her brood scamper around the enclosure in Hagenbeck Zoo in Hamburg, Germany. Wildlife photographer and engineer Yosuke Tani, 33, captured the delightful scene during a visit to the German zoo. Yosuke, who lives in Osaka, Japan, says: “Bear cubs are extremely playful.
